In the United States, women represent about 50% of students enrolled in architecture programs, but only 18% of licensed architects are women. Inspired by the AIASF Missing 32% Symposium, this group is for young professional women who want to share their experiences, insights and strategies for navigating firm culture, developing communication skills and approaching leadership development. This is a Meet Up for people interested in Neuro Linguistic Programming (NLP). NLP is called "The Study of the Structure of Human Experience." It is also a self development practice: Once we know something about how we structure our experience, we can find ways to re-structure it in ways that provide us with the experience of life we would prefer.
